Scutosaurus karpinskii Variant:Primed prehistoric marine reptiles similar toScutosaurus karpinskii is an extinct species of anapsid like reptile that lived during the Permian period, approximately 252 to 248 million years ago. It was part of a group of animals known as parareptiles, which were neither dinosaurs nor mammals, but a separate lineage of reptiles that shared unique characteristics.
